Document Transport — Print Shop Master Copies

Quick guide for moving master copies to Bramblehurst Print Co. These are the only originals, so treat the run like a valuables transfer, not a regular parcel drop. Use the red tamper-evident envelopes from the supply shelf, log the seal number in the transport book, and never combine the run with general mail. The masters go directly to the press supervisor, nobody else. On arrival, the courier must follow the hand-over instruction stated below.

drop instructions, kajep-tageg: the kasvan casdor courier leaves the quenvan quenox druox ledger at gate 4316 under passcode 799004

Note for plugin authors: the Quillcheck documentation linter now runs in strict mode on CI, so previously tolerated warnings (missing alt text, bare heading jumps) will fail your plugin's docs build. Please update before the next release window. If your build fails unexpectedly, rerun once, then file a report quoting the token shown below.

trace token, fafog-kageg: htk4_98e6

Hey — handing off the hot-reload work on Confetti (our config service) before I'm out. Watcher picks up changes via inotify, validates against the schema, then swaps the atomic pointer; no restart needed. One gotcha: nested overrides don't merge, they replace wholesale, which surprised the Brindleworth team twice. Tests cover the swap path but not partial failures yet. Review notes, open questions, and the design doc are all on the internal page here.

wiki page, tahaf-tajog: https://jira.ordindyn.corp/pipeline

- [ ] **Step 7: Breaker override escrow.** After sealing the signing keys for the Tallgrove upstream API circuit breaker, confirm the support team can force the breaker open during a full outage. The override bundle lives in the sealed escrow drawer and is useless without its unlock phrase. Two ceremony witnesses must initial this step before proceeding. The escrow bundle is decrypted with the recovery passphrase that follows.

vault phrase of kahip-kahop = holath-quenmir